Best Recipe for Sam's Spam Schnitzel with Truffleyaki Sauce over Kim Chee Fried Rice

Ingredients

  • 1 can Spam
  • Flour, for dredging
  • 2 eggs mixed with 1/2 cup water
  • 2 cups panko bread crumbs
  • 2 tablespoons butter, for frying
  • Kim Chee Fried Rice, recipe follows
  • Truffleyaki Sauce, recipe follows
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• 3 pieces lop cheong, (Chinese sausage) sliced thinly on a diagonal
  • 1/2 cup bacon, diced
  • 1/2 pound shrimp, cooked and chopped
  • 1 cup yellow onion, diced
  • 1/2 cup green onion, sliced
  • 6 cups cooked rice
  • 3 eggs, beaten
  • 3 tablespoons oyster sauce
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1/2 cup kim chee, chopped
  • Salt and pepper
  • 1 cup soy sauce
  • 1 medium orange, juiced
  • 1/2 cup mirin
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ons minced garlic
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ons minced ginger
  • 1 tablespoon black truffle shavings
  • 1/2 tablespoon truffle oil
  • 3 ounces butter

Instructions

  1. Slice Spam into 6 slices. Dredge in flour, then dip in egg wash and press into panko. Pan-fry in butter until golden brown. Serve on Kim Chee Fried Rice and top with Truffleyaki Sauce.
  2. Pour the oil in nonstick wok and saute the lop cheong and bacon for 2 minutes on medium-high heat. Drain excess oil. Add shrimp and onions and saute for 2 to 3 minutes. Add rice and saute for another 3 minutes. Add oyster sauce, soy sauce, kim chee, salt and pepper and saute until liquid evaporates. Make a well in the center of the rice and add eggs. Let sit for 1 to 2 minutes until solid. Shred with a spatula and mix into rice. Garnish with green onion.
  3. Combine all ingredients except butter and blend well. Bring to a boil and whisk in butter.
